Abstract
A noise control device includes: four or more noise detectors each for detecting a plurality of noises arriving thereat, and outputting the noises as a noise signal; a control speaker for radiating, to a control point, a control sound based on each noise signal; and a filter section for signal-processing noise signals from the noise detectors by using filter coefficients which respectively correspond to the four or more noise detectors and which are set such that the control sound from the control speaker reduces the plurality of noises arriving at the control point, and for adding up all the signal-processed noise signals, and for outputting a resultant signal to the control speaker. The control point and the control speaker are provided within a polyhedral-shaped space whose apexes are placement positions of the noise detectors.

16. A noise control device for reducing a plurality of noises arriving at a control point by radiating a control sound to the control point, the noise control device comprising:
-
four or more noise detectors each for detecting the plurality of noises arriving thereat, and outputting the detected noises as a noise signal; a control speaker for radiating, to the control point, the control sound based on each noise signal; and a filter section for signal-processing noise signals from the noise detectors by using filter coefficients which respectively correspond to the four or more noise detectors and which are set such that the control sound from the control speaker reduces the plurality of noises arriving at the control point, and for adding up all the signal-processed noise signals, and for outputting a resultant signal to the control speaker, wherein a three-dimensional space is defined within the noise detectors, and the control point and the control speaker are provided within the three-dimensional space, wherein the noise detectors are positioned such that a relationship a≦
c/2f is satisfied for each noise detector, wherein the distance from the adjacent noise detector is a, a sound velocity is c, and the upper-limit frequency of the control band is f. - View Dependent Claims (17, 18, 19, 20)
